Enhanced Flow Capacity & Service Life
The 9-inch extended length offers approximately 80% more active media area than a standard 5-inch filter. This allows it to support significantly higher flow rates or, at equivalent flows, greatly extend service intervals, reducing maintenance frequency, downtime, and total cost of ownership.
High-Efficiency Coalescing Performance
Incorporates a multi-layered, gradient-density glass fiber or synthetic media pack designed for efficient coalescence, typically rated to remove liquid and solid contaminants down to ≥0.1 µm.
Consistently maintains low outlet fluid contamination, with residual oil content generally ≤0.1 ppm under standard operating conditions.
Optimized System Efficiency
The increased surface area results in lower face velocity for a given flow, which typically translates to a lower initial pressure drop and more stable long-term pressure differential. This design contributes to reduced energy consumption of the compressor or blower over the filter's lifespan.
Robust Construction & Reliable Compatibility
Built with a durable metal support core and epoxy-bonded metal end caps to withstand system pulsations and pressure cycles.
Features a standard industrial connection (commonly a M30×1.5 male thread for 9-inch housings), ensuring secure installation and compatibility with designated extended-length filter housings from various manufacturers.
